Assemble the Cobbler:
Remove the baking dish from the oven once the butter has melted.
Pour the batter evenly over the melted butter. Do not stir.
Spoon the lemon pie filling over the top of the batter. Spread it gently, but do not mix—it will settle as it bakes, creating the “magic” layers.
Bake:
Bake the cobbler in the preheated oven for 40-45 minutes, or until the top is golden and the edges are bubbling.
Cool and Serve:
Let the cobbler cool for 5-10 minutes to allow the layers to set.
Serve warm, optionally topped with whipped cream or vanilla ice cream for extra indulgence.
Tips:
For Extra Zest: Add a teaspoon of fresh lemon zest to the batter for an extra citrusy punch.
Storage: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ven or microwave before serving.
Versatility: Swap the lemon pie filling for another flavor (e.g., peach, blueberry, or cherry) to create a different cobbler variation.
